For scores of farmers and sharemilkers around the country, June 1st has become known as Gypsy Day -- when farms change ownership and families move entire households, farm equipment and cattle to a new property on busy Queen's Birthday weekend. This evocative story celebrates an important day on the New Zealand farming calendar through the eyes of a young boy and his sister.

Gypsy day marks an important date in the New Zealand farming calendar where many farming families (and their stock) move from one property to another. In this story a young boy describes what it is like to move house and a whole herd of cows on the same day. First person recount. Includes brief factual information.
